"I am clear about my role. I am the Nonna. My kids have a right to raise their family the way they want.....Being a Nonna entails opening myself up to certain kinds of suffering. I feel great love and responsibility, yet I have almost no control."
Eye of My Heart, Mary Pipher, Ph.D.


Becoming a grandparent is a major life transition. It calls into question family relationships, time, boundaries, and roles, the past and the future. While it is often joyful, there can be other complexities that are not as apparent as popular media will have you believe.
